SAP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

539 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SAP (SAP)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$8.55B — up 8.9% from $7.85B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 69 funds opened new SAP positions and 35 closed out — a net gain of 34 holders — while 174 added to existing stakes and 196 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fisher Asset Management, adding an estimated $29.2M. The largest seller was Arrowstreet Capital, cutting an estimated $43.6M.
